Summary

CVE-2024-35581 is a medium-severity Code Injection (CWE-94) vulnerability in Oretnom23 Computer Laboratory Management System. Its CVSS base score is 6.1 (Medium).

Operationally, ranked in the top 34.4%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.

EU & UK References

Vulnerability details

A cross-site scripting (XSS) vulnerability in Sourcecodester Laboratory Management System v1.0 allows attackers to execute arbitrary web scripts or HTML via a crafted payload injected into the Borrower Name input field.
